For areas where cable infrastructure is less developed or for those seeking a broader national channel selection, satellite TV remains a viable option in Montgomery, VT. The primary satellite providers serving the region are DirecTV and Dish Network. Installation typically requires a clear, unobstructed view of the southern sky to receive satellite signals effectively, which is generally achievable in most Montgomery residences, including single-family homes and some townhouses. Given Vermont's climate, residents should be aware that heavy snowfall or ice accumulation on the satellite dish can temporarily disrupt service, though systems are designed to withstand most weather conditions.
Cable TV providers in Montgomery, VT, ensure access to essential local broadcast channels, which is a significant draw for many residents. Viewers can typically expect to receive ABC, CBS, NBC, and PBS affiliates through their cable service. For example, WPTZ (NBC) and WCAX-TV (CBS) are commonly available, providing local news, weather, and programming relevant to Vermont and the surrounding Northeastern region. FOX affiliates may also be included depending on the specific package and provider. While regional sports networks can vary, some packages might include access to channels that broadcast Vermont-based sports or events, enhancing the local viewing experience. Furthermore, many cable providers offer access to public access channels specific to Montgomery or Franklin County, offering community-focused content and local government broadcasts.
